The hilarious thing is to think back on how we got him - when Charlie Corluka decided he wanted to go and play with his friend Modric at Spurs, we were a bit affronted because Corluka showed real promise and who was this Zabaleta chap? But it was similar money all round. Corluka's moved on to Lokomotiv Moscow now but I know who got the best of the deal. Was Zabba really a Hughes signing?
